Boc-D-3-Chlorophenylalanine, characterized by its unique chlorine substitution on the phenyl ring and the tert-butyloxycarbonyl (Boc) protecting group, offers distinct advantages in peptide chain elongation. The D-configuration ensures stereochemical integrity, while the chlorine atom can modulate the electronic and steric properties of the final peptide, potentially enhancing binding affinity to target receptors or improving metabolic stability.

It is frequently employed in the development of peptide-based therapeutics, including novel drug candidates for oncology, metabolic disorders, and neurological conditions. Researchers often seek this specific derivative to introduce specific conformational constraints or to fine-tune the pharmacokinetic profiles of their peptide constructs.
